""Fragment Of An Uncanonical Gospel From Oxyrhynchus"" is a book written by Bernard P. Grenfell. The book is a scholarly work that focuses on a fragment of an uncanonical gospel that was discovered in Oxyrhynchus in Egypt. The gospel fragment is written in Greek and is believed to date back to the second century. The book provides a detailed analysis of the fragment, including its content, language, and historical context. It also discusses the significance of the fragment for the study of early Christianity and the development of the New Testament canon.
